This take-out site on the Calapooia River near Brownsville serves as an exit point for whitewater paddlers completing runs on this popular Oregon river. The Calapooia is known for its moderate whitewater sections and scenic valley setting in Linn County. As a dedicated take-out location, this site provides paddlers with vehicle access to retrieve boats and gear after their river trip.
Paddlers using this take-out should be prepared for typical whitewater river conditions with moderate current and potential obstacles common to Oregon's Willamette Valley rivers. The site's location in Brownsville offers reasonable access to the river corridor, though boaters should verify current conditions and any seasonal access restrictions before planning their trip.
